Change of spectral output with pressure and white light generation in nanoscale Yb3+:Y2Si2O7
- 1. Istanbul Tech Univ, Dept Phys Engn, TR-34469 Istanbul, Turkey
- 2. Boston Coll, Dept Phys, Chestnut Hill, MA 02467 USA
Description
We report the drastic dependence on pressure of the spectral output of sol-gel derived Yb3+:Y2Si2O7 nanoparticles when excited with the 950 nm emission of a laser diode. The average particle size was estimated 40 nm. The spectrum obtained at atmospheric pressure consisted of an intense blue band. At low pressure the spectrum changed to a wide optical band.
